MSP Recovery, Inc. specializes in recovering medical expenses for healthcare providers, leveraging proprietary data analytics to identify and recover funds from insurers. The company's unique position stems from its extensive database and relationships with various healthcare entities across the U.S., particularly in the Medicare and Medicaid sectors.
MSP Recovery generates revenue primarily through contingency fees on recovered funds for healthcare providers. The company benefits from a unique data-driven approach that enhances recovery rates, providing a competitive edge in the healthcare recovery space.
